People who had gone through a divorce warned me when it finally becomes final I would most likely be sad or even depressed about it. I could not fathom that - I had endured 16 yrs of verbal and emotional abuse. I found out those people were right.

When the divorce was finally over I did find myself sad, I cried for a week. I could not understand why until a friend told me I was mourning the life and relationship I never had and had always hoped for. It was true, I spent most of those years giving it another chance, giving him another chance, hoping with all my heart things would change but they never did. Getting those signed papers in mail was a relief but it also forced me to put those hopes and dreams on a shelf.

I eventually took those hopes and dreams down...Life goes on with or without you.
